Transaction 905022781d86efab2fd74f58a6e0ec9cf70d424b3c3bc3e1c3bac4daeeb20612
1 Input
1 Output
-
905022781d86efab2fd74f58a6e0ec9cf70d424b3c3bc3e1c3bac4daeeb20612:0
- value
- 309155
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b267583f3af2c3b14b192ea4e43d63345200d20
- address
- bc1qevn8tqln4ukrk993jt4yus7kxdzjqrfq39f0sk